Title: Misha Dinerman: Innovator in Thyroid Beta-Agonist Treatments

Introduction

Misha Dinerman is a notable inventor based in Cincinnati, OH (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of medicine, particularly in the treatment of X-linked adrenoleukodystrophy. With a total of 3 patents to his name, Dinerman's work has the potential to impact many lives.

Latest Patents

Dinerman's latest patents focus on the use of thyroid beta-agonists. These methods are particularly useful for treating X-linked adrenoleukodystrophy, showcasing his commitment to advancing medical treatments.
